Blown vs. Cast Film: A Stretch Wrap Explainer

If you've ever stood staring at a pallet wondering how to best secure it, you know stretch wrap is a lifesaver. But all those rolls on the shelf aren't created equal. There are actually two main types – blown and cast – and figuring out the difference can make a world of difference for your goods (and your sanity!). 
 
How It's Made (Yes, This Matters!) 
 
Cast Film: Imagine those super quick chefs, flipping a thin, flat pancake onto a plate. That's kind of like cast film. Molten plastic is spread out, then rapidly cooled on a roller – think super-fast pancake making. This makes a thin film that's super clear and unwraps without making too much fuss. 

 
Blown Film: Picture a giant bubble getting blown upwards. That's the idea behind blown film. The plastic is extruded up, cooled by air, and forms a thicker, tougher wrap. It's a little clingier, too. 
 

So, What Does This Mean for You? 
 
Clear as Day: Need to scan barcodes or see what's inside the pallet? Cast film is your winner, hands down. Blown film is a little cloudier. 

Tough Stuff: If you're wrapping stuff with pointy corners or heavy loads, blown film has your back. It's great at resisting those frustrating punctures. 
 

Shhh... It's Warehouse Time: Cast film unrolls a lot more quietly. If you've got a busy warehouse, this can make a difference in the noise levels. 
 

Pounds and Pence: In general, blown film costs a smidge more to make, so the price tag might be a little higher. 
 

The Bottom Line 
 
There's no clear "best" here. It's all about what your priorities are: 
 
Protection is King: Blown film 
Clarity Matters: Cast film 
Need to Save Noise and Money: Cast film might be the way to go
